The Riverside Court Hotel, Sheffield

Advantages: Near City Centre, Good value for money, River view
Disadvantages: On a busy road

The Riverside Court Hotel is situated just outside Sheffield City Centre within a few minutes walk of the main markets and one of the main Shopping areas of the City. It occupies a prominent position on the corner of Nursery Street, where it meets the Wicker. Historically the Wicker is an area of the City that was once a thriving part of Sheffield with lots of Shops and Businesses. Today it is rather run down, although improvements are currently underway, and most of the businesses in this area are now take aways and other fast food outlets. The Riverside Court Hotel actually occupies quite an enviable location at the top end of the Wicker. Safari Court Hotel

Advantages: Comfortable, international full service hotel
Disadvantages: Busy front desk

I have stayed at the Safari Court twice. Both times it was very busy and appears to be one of the most popular hotels in Windhoek for international travelers and businessmen. Everything was very professionally done. The rooms were well appointed with two double beds. The AC worked well. The bathrooms were fairly spacious. The reception area got very busy at times and one might have a wait to get their key. The lounge was comfortable with plenty of open seating areas for reading the local paper. The restaurant has excellent a la carte selections that were surprising for their quality. A buffet was available for breakfast and dinner with typical breakfast fare. Cedar Court left me wanting more!

Advantages: Close to M62. Wide range of facilities.
Disadvantages: Robotic staff, boring rooms. Testosterone fueled bar.

Work can require me to visit the lovely world of West Yorkshire from time to time and the closest hotel to my office, happens to be the Cedar Court Huddersfield. I have stayed there once but wouldn?t rush back. The only thing going for it in my opinion is the closeness to the M62 and the cheap corporate rate! Arrival The hotel is situated just off the M62 at Ainley Top making it handy for the local road links. There is an abundance of on-site car parking which is free for residents and at night there is a security guard outside throughout the darker hours to help keep your car safe. Check In Check in was straightforward if a little robotic. We were processed through, credit cards swiped and then given the key to our rooms.
